Figures are medians of loans actually originated in 2025, as reported under the Home Mortgage Disclosure Act. They describe what borrowers received, not what you would be offered: HMDA contains no credit scores, so these numbers cannot be read as pricing for any individual. Lender fees are reported for 70% of loans here — see methodology.
